Stress Analysis Engineer
ABOUT FIREFLY AEROSPACE
As an end-to-end space transportation company, Firefly Aerospace is on a mission to enable our world to launch, land, and operate in space - anywhere, anytime. Our launch vehicles, lunar landers, and orbital vehicles provide government and commercial customers with full mission services from low Earth orbit to the surface of the Moon and beyond. Headquartered in north Austin, Texas, Firefly is looking for passionate, hardworking innovators to join our team and help fuel our successful trajectory into space.
SUMMARY
As a Stress Analyst on the Mechanical Engineering Team, you will be responsible for analysis of various structures across multiple projects including spacecraft, launch vehicle structures, and launch and test ground support equipment. You will use your knowledge of structural analysis to improve previous designs and influence new designs by minimizing weight and at the same time ensuring conformance to program and customer strength and stability requirements. You will leverage testing of hardware to correlate and validate analysis models.
RESPONSIBILITIES
- Collaborate with design, manufacturing, and test engineering to develop hardware throughout the design lifecycle
- Perform structural analyses by classical hand calculation and finite element analysis for composites and metals.
- Perform linear and non-linear structural analysis, eigenvalue buckling analysis, non-linear buckling analysis, and modal finite element analysis using ANSYS and NX Nastran.
- Develop test requirements to ensure adequate data for analysis correlation.
- Validate finite element analysis with hand calculations and test data.
- Review internal and external analyses.
- Work with responsible and systems engineers to define required material properties and part modifications to meet structural requirements.
- Write strength and stability margins to required program safety factors.
QUALIFICATIONS
Required
- Master's Degree in Mechanical, Aerospace, or civil engineering and 2+ years of relevant experience, or 5+ years with a Bachelor's Degree.
- Proficient with analytical simulation software and hand calculations for structural analysis.
- Familiarity with aerospace standard analysis methods.
- Ability to effectively work in a multi-discipline team and provide technical guidance and insight.
- Exceptional comprehension of first principles related to structures and materials.
